/* Macros */

#if defined(HAVE_LOGIN_GETCAPBOOL) && defined(HAVE_LOGIN_CAP_H)
# define HAVE_LOGIN_CAP
#endif

#ifndef MAX
# define MAX(a,b) (((a)>(b))?(a):(b))
# define MIN(a,b) (((a)<(b))?(a):(b))
#endif

#ifndef roundup
# define roundup(x, y)   ((((x)+((y)-1))/(y))*(y))
#endif

#ifndef timersub
#define timersub(a, b, result)					\
   do {								\
      (result)->tv_sec = (a)->tv_sec - (b)->tv_sec;		\
      (result)->tv_usec = (a)->tv_usec - (b)->tv_usec;		\
      if ((result)->tv_usec < 0) {				\
	 --(result)->tv_sec;					\
	 (result)->tv_usec += 1000000;				\
      }								\
   } while (0)
#endif

#ifndef __P
# define __P(x) x
#endif

#if !defined(IN6_IS_ADDR_V4MAPPED)
# define IN6_IS_ADDR_V4MAPPED(a) \
	((((u_int32_t *) (a))[0] == 0) && (((u_int32_t *) (a))[1] == 0) && \
	 (((u_int32_t *) (a))[2] == htonl (0xffff)))
#endif /* !defined(IN6_IS_ADDR_V4MAPPED) */

#if !defined(__GNUC__) || (__GNUC__ < 2)
# define __attribute__(x)
#endif /* !defined(__GNUC__) || (__GNUC__ < 2) */

/* *-*-nto-qnx doesn't define this macro in the system headers */
#ifdef MISSING_HOWMANY
# define howmany(x,y)	(((x)+((y)-1))/(y))
#endif

#ifndef OSSH_ALIGNBYTES
#define OSSH_ALIGNBYTES	(sizeof(int) - 1)
#endif
#ifndef __CMSG_ALIGN
#define	__CMSG_ALIGN(p) (((u_int)(p) + OSSH_ALIGNBYTES) &~ OSSH_ALIGNBYTES)
#endif

/* Length of the contents of a control message of length len */
#ifndef CMSG_LEN
#define	CMSG_LEN(len)	(__CMSG_ALIGN(sizeof(struct cmsghdr)) + (len))
#endif

/* Length of the space taken up by a padded control message of length len */
#ifndef CMSG_SPACE
#define	CMSG_SPACE(len)	(__CMSG_ALIGN(sizeof(struct cmsghdr)) + __CMSG_ALIGN(len))
#endif
